29 Dec 2022
10 Dec 2022
02 Dec 2022
11 Nov 2022
10 Nov 2022
24 Sep 2022
23 Sep 2022
17 Sep 2022
  • Crafted level 5 badge for Dota 2
15 Sep 2022
  • Crafted level 5 badge for Raft
  • Crafted level 1 badge for Terraria
13 Sep 2022
06 Sep 2022
31 Aug 2022
  • Crafted level 4 badge for Freebie
25 Mar 2022
  • 2 years on Steam
09 Mar 2022
07 Mar 2022
06 Mar 2022
02 Mar 2022
31 Jan 2022